Akachi Adimora-Ezeigbo // (listen) nyela sasabira ŋun yina Nigeria ka o tuma nima jendi yeltoɣ'taɣimalisi, lahabali ŋmahi, bihi kundunima, ni lahabali tibo. [1] O nyela ŋun di kpaŋmaŋ pina pam Nigeria tingbani ni, ka di puuni sheli nye Nigeria Prize for Literature.[2]
O Biɛhigu
[mali niŋ | mali mi di yibu sheena n-niŋ]Akachi Adimora-Ezeigbo nyela bini da doɣi ka wumsi so Nigeria wulin puhili yaɣili, amaa ka o pa be Lagos. Ŋuni n nye bikpem bihi ayobu ni zaŋti o ba Joshua ni o ma Christiana Adimora. Di bahi bahandi bi daa wumsi o tinkpaŋa ni foŋ ni la, o nyela ŋun zaŋ lala binyera ŋo zaa n pahi o lahabaya ni kperiti sabbu ni. Bi ni doɣi o Nigeria wulinpuhili yaɣili maa zaa yoli, o nyela ŋun na mini be Nigeria boba ni yaya. o lahi nyela ŋun go pam africa tingbana ni, Europe ni USA.
O daa karimya ka deeigi Machelor of Arts(BA) ni Masters (MA) shahira gbana silimsili yaɣili University of Lagos ka daa lahi karim deeigi Ph.D shahira gbaŋ University of Ibadan, Nigeria.
O nyela karimba, sasabira, lahabalitira ni din pahi pahi ka daa nye bini piigi so professor zaŋkpa siliminsili yaɣili , University of lagos yuuni 1999. O nyela ŋun wuhi lala karinzoŋ ŋo ni, yaɣa sheli din dahi siliminsili bohimbu polo tum yuuni 1981 . O daa lahi nyela bini piigi so kpema zaŋ ti karinzoŋ maa siliminsili bohimbu yaɣili yuuni 1997 ni 1998, yuuni 2002 hali ni 2005, ni yuuni 2008 hali ni 2009. Silimin goli September yuuni 2015, o daa nyela ŋun yi karinzoŋ maa ni n labi federal University Ndufu-alike, Ikwo, Ebonyi State, din be Nigeria nuzaa zuɣu , luɣi sheli o ni kuli lahi tuɣi karimbihi wuhibu ka lahi wumsiri karimba bihi.
O nyela ŋun kuli professor Chris Ezeigbo ka bi mali bihi ata.
Tuma
[mali niŋ | mali mi di yibu sheena n-niŋ]O nyela ŋun wuhi karinzoŋ bihi ni poi ka naayi nti leegi karimba nti karinzoŋ kara maa. O daa lahi nyela ŋun pahi lihiri ka vihiri lahabaya poi ka di naayi wuligi zaŋti lahabali wuligibu tuma duri ŋo -The Independent (1992–1995) ni The Post Express (1997–1999). O lahi nyela ŋun daa gbubi kpamli saha sehli o ni daa be University of Lagos, kpem zaŋti karinzoŋ maa Faculty of Arts yuuni 1992 hali ni 1994 ni Kpem zaŋti karinzoŋ maa silimisili bohimbu yaɣili yuuni 1997 hali ni 1998 ni din pahi pahi.
Ŋuni n daa lahi nye ŋun lihiri liɣri yeltoɣa zuɣu zaŋti Nigeria Sasabiriba yuuni 1995 hali ni 1997, zuɣulaan paa zaŋti Women Writers of Nigeria" Nigeria sasabiraba ban nye paɣaba laɣangu" yuuni 1998 hali ni 2000. Pumpoŋo ŋuni n ye zuɣulaan paa zaŋti P.E.N Nigeria.

O ni pahi Laɣansi sheŋa ni
o nyela ŋun be laɣinsi pam ni kamani Literary Society of Nigeria, Modern Languages Association of Nigeria. O lahi nyela ŋun be laɣansi zaŋti sasabiriba kamani , International PEN, PEN Nigeria, Association of Nigerian Authors (ANA) ni Women Writers Association of Nigeria (WRITA).
Ŋuni n daa nye tuuli zuɣulaan paa zaŋti PEN Nigeria.
